Plumbing Pumps & Intro to Bluetooth Communications

This class covers how water moves through a pool system  plumbing size, flow calculation, hydraulics, and pressure and how variable speed pumps operate, including the relationship between speed, flow, and energy consumption along with proper installation best practices. Pool pros will configure, program, and schedule pumps, optimize speeds for common pool applications and peripheral devices, and set up OmniX on the VS pump to enable wireless, decentralized automation without a control panel.

Automation & Electrical Wiring

This class covers what automation entails and how to correctly select and size a system based on pool and spa equipment, features, and electrical requirements. Pool pros will install and wire automation controls, relays, sensors, and communication connections, integrate pumps, heaters, sanitization, lighting, and accessories, configure and program core functions including schedules, modes, Wi-Fi, interlocks, and water feature controls, and diagnose power, wiring, relay, and communication faults using schematics and live measurements.

Sanitation

This sanitization class covers the different types of sanitization equipment and how each one works, along with the selection and installation process, wiring, communication to automation, and maintenance requirements. Pool pros will learn how salt systems work and how salt water chemistry differs from liquid chlorine, how HydraPure operates along with its benefits, installation, and when a degasser is or isn’t needed, and how HLSense monitoring works including its requirements on commercial pools — then plumb and wire an S3 Omni panel with all three devices, covering wiring connections, simple automation and programming, plumbing configurations and best practices, and troubleshooting.

Heaters & Heat Pumps Installation & Programming

This is a class that covers California Title 24 requirements, how gas heaters and heat pumps work, and how to size a heater correctly for pool and spa volume, hydraulic conditions, climate, and application. Pool pros will apply proper installation practices for gas supply, venting, combustion air, plumbing, electrical, and bonding, verify compliance with safety and manufacturer guidelines, and wire and configure heater controls including automation integration.
